| Description | This course introduces students to different wireless technologies, including spread spectrum transmission, orthogonal frequency-division multiplexing (OFDM), multiple-input and multiple-output (MIMO), and radio frequency management. The course discusses the 802.11 MAC frame and analyzes different types of channel access methods in wireless networks. Wireless LAN (WLAN) management, architecture, and design concepts and requirements are covered in detail. The course introduces troubleshooting best practices and how to investigate Wi-Fi problems. Students will gain the knowledge required to install, configure, and troubleshoot wireless controller-based networks, wireless mesh networks, and quality of service implementation in wireless networks. Additionally, the course covers network security, intrusion detection systems, and intrusion prevention systems in wireless networks. |
